Greenhouses provide ideal environments for the cultivation of sensitive plants, but they require care to maintain and improve. High-pressure humidification technology is a revolutionary method of climate control in greenhouses. This method dilutes the water droplets to the micron level, allowing them to spread through the greenhouse in the form of “fog” or “mist”. This thin layer of mist helps to regulate the temperature and humidity balance in the greenhouse in a natural and efficient way.

How does fogging work?

A high-pressure humidification system works by spraying water under high pressure. The system turns the water into “fogsis”, which ensures a homogeneous moisture distribution in the greenhouse. This keeps the humidity at ideal levels, which is essential for healthy plant growth, and reduces costs by reducing water consumption. In addition, the“fogging” technology also contributes to disease prevention, as the right level of humidity creates an unfavorable environment for disease-causing organisms.

Energy and Water Savings with High Pressure Humidification

Misting systems use water with maximum efficiency. These systems reduce the water droplets to such a small size that the evaporation rate is maximized, which saves energy.
